50 Metaphors About Autumn With Meanings & Sentences

Metaphors About Autumn

1. Autumn is a sunset

Meaning: Autumn marks the end of the year, much like a sunset marks the end of the day.
In a Sentence: The red and orange leaves of autumn are like a sunset, signaling the close of the year.
Other Ways to Say: Autumn is the day’s end, Autumn is the final chapter.

2. Autumn is a cozy blanket

Meaning: The season feels comforting and warm, much like a soft blanket.
In a Sentence: The cool autumn air wrapped around me like a cozy blanket.
Other Ways to Say: Autumn is a warm hug, Autumn is a soft sweater.

3. Autumn is a golden fire

Meaning: The season glows with golden, fiery colors.
In a Sentence: The forest blazed like a golden fire in the heart of autumn.
Other Ways to Say: Autumn is a burning ember, Autumn is a golden glow.
